No relief on petrol in Haryana

CHANDIGARH: Acting on the directions of Congress president Sonia Gandhi, the Haryana Government on Friday reduced VAT on diesel while abolishing it on cooking gas but did not give any relief on petrol.

“VAT on diesel has been reduced from 12 per cent to 8.8 per cent and LPG has been made VAT-free. There would be no relief to the consumers using petrol,” Haryana Chief Minister Bhupinder Singh Hooda told reporters after a special meeting of his Cabinet.

The changes in VAT would result in a reduction in the price of diesel and cooking gas by approximately Re.1 and Rs.13, respectively, following the steep hike in the prices announced by the Congress-led UPA government at the Centre two days ago. - PTI
